Migration Guide — Step 2: Point producers at the Hollowfen schema registry

Update each event producer to fetch schemas from the new Hollowfen registry instead of the embedded copies. Register existing schemas first so compatibility checks pass, then flip the producer flag service by service. Do not mix registered and embedded schemas within one topic. Producers connect using the registry settings shown here.

deployment values, yahag-tawef:
ZORWYN_HOST=zorwyn.tolvaqlabs.internal
ZORWYN_PORT=9300

Finance Review Summary — Q3 Budget Request, Kestrelline Foods

Quick recap for branch managers: the Harwick depot's request for an extra 140k to refit the cold-storage line mostly checks out. Margins at the depot have held steady, and the payback window looks like roughly 18 months, which is inside our usual comfort zone. We trimmed the contingency line a bit because, frankly, it was padded. Approval is recommended with minor conditions. One caveat ties into wider plans for the region.

confidential, kagep-kahof: Druokax Systems plans to lower the Ulaath list price by 53 percent in March.

Fan-out backpressure for the Quillet notifier: when the queue depth crosses the soft limit, the dispatcher sheds low-priority pushes and batches the rest at 500ms intervals. Reviewer should confirm the shed counter is exported and that retries respect the jitter window. Once merged, the release artifact gets re-signed by the pipeline, which expects the deploy key shown below.

deploy key for bawep-yawif: bky6_GQhaSt